Output 38803c790682aae19bd7a0893edcbd1a56e441ffe274818ca15c871d66ba20ac:2

value
49801289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 455dcbc32c57f6f790e21ae7f541351531998f4e OP_EQUAL
address
381nuqUtKUdTDBHq9Sff4yXWWNDQXe4yhD
transaction
38803c790682aae19bd7a0893edcbd1a56e441ffe274818ca15c871d66ba20ac
spent
true